That's easy - Tobermory, Ontario. I used to live in Wiarton, about an hour south of here. Little Tub Harbour is the bay with the marina; the Chi-Cheemaun (ferry to Manitoulin Island) departs from the mouth of Little Tub Harbour. The other bay is Big Tub Harbour; there's a fantastic restaurant there (Big Tub Resort) that has excellent live music. The Bruce Trail also ends here. I was fortunate to hike from Tobermory to Owen Sound this past summer - it was a fantastic experience.

The features are Western Brook Pond and Gros Morne itself. The brown spot is ophiolite, or ocean crust which has been pushed up onto the continental crust. Usually oceanic crust subducts because it is more dense, so it is somewhat rare to encounter it exposed on the surface like this.
